Just Cause 4 story trailer released

October 10, 2018 by Andrew Newton

Square Enix has released the story trailer for the upcoming Just Cause 4 providing a preview of what’s in store for our protagonist Rico Rodriguez.  Just Cause 4 will be available on 4th December for the Xbox One, Playstation and PC.  You can see this new trailer below…

In this new trailer we see Rico Rodriguez, who’s now gone rogue from the Agency, travel to the South American inspired Island of Solís in order to discover who was behind his father’s death.  The island is in a state of civil unrest and the Black Hand militia, led by the dangerous Gabriella, are trying to keep the situation under control.  As Rico comes to understand the politics of the island he must figure out a way to continue with his investigation, and with help from a local rebel called Mira he may be able to find out what happened to his father.

Now rogue from the Agency, Rico Rodriguez visits Solís in South America hell bent on uncovering the truth behind his father’s death. This huge, beautiful South American island is home to violent tornadoes and storms while its locals are kept under control by the ruthless Black Hand militia led by the dangerous Gabriela. Rico soon forms an alliance with Mira, a rebellious dissident before finding himself leading an army as he fights, grapples and wingsuits his way through conspiracies and chaos.

Just Cause 4 will bring grappling and wingsuit action to gamers this December.
